You may never eat store bought bread after making this.
2 ¼ Cups warm water.
4 ½ tsp (2 packets) Active Dry yeast.
¼ Cup white sugar.
1 TBSP salt.
¼ Cup Vegetable oil, ( & extra for oiling)
6 ¼ Cups all purpose flour ( I use organic unbleached all purpose flour)
How To:
1.Whisk warm water, yeast & sugar together.
Stir in salt & Vegetable oil. Mix one cup of flour at a time into mixture until dough is s sticky but pulls easily from surface. Knead for 7 minutes or until dough comes off your hands easily without sticking. You can also use dough machine .
2. Roll dough into a ball, place in an oiled bowl & cover with towel for one hour.
Place dough on floured surface, knead for one minute and divide if you are using regular size pans. My pan is 13.385 *5.3 *4.72 inch & this dough is enough for that and a smaller pan as well. Shape the divided dough and place into lightly oiled pans
3. Cover pans and let rise for another 1 HR. Move oven rack to low setting and preheat oven to 375°F.
4. Bake on the low rack for 30-35 minutes or until golden brown.
5. Remove from oven and cool before slicing. Store in an airtight container at room temperature for a few days or freeze for longer storage.
